The Adventures of Wally and Warren Series: The Reluctant Penguin by Lise Chase
The Adventures of Wally and Warren continue wit their love of books. Hunkering down for bedtime, Warren is determined to read a bedtime story. Remembering how mom taught him how to sound out the words he is confident he can do it. Not to be thwarted by Wally’s negativity of anything Warren wants to try himself, Warren puts his best foot forward to each task Warren’s attempts are admirable. Does Wally ever learn that one must try new things to expand their horizons or does Wally remain wrapped up in his self-doubt?
Lise Chase expertly creates a world of positive outlook of doing versus others negativity.
